Exploring the Origins and Evolution of Chiropractic Care Chiropractic care, a healthcare discipline that focuses on diagnosing and treating musculoskeletal disorders, particularly those involving the spine, has roots that trace back to the late 19th century. It was founded on the principle that proper alignment of the body's musculoskeletal structure, especially the spine, enables the body to heal itself without the need for drugs or surgery. Over time, chiropractic has evolved to incorporate evidence-based practices, blending traditional methods with modern research to ensure safety and efficacy. The emphasis is on holistic wellness, recognizing the intricate connection between spinal health, nervous system function, and overall bodily well-being.

The Techniques and Modalities Used in Chiropractic Practice Chiropractic techniques vary widely depending on the practitioner’s training and the patient’s needs. Manual adjustments are the most common method, involving controlled, sudden force applied to specific spinal joints to improve alignment. Other modalities may include soft tissue therapy, spinal decompression, rehabilitative exercises, ultrasound, and electrical stimulation. Some chiropractors integrate complementary practices such as massage therapy, acupuncture, and nutrition counseling to create a comprehensive treatment plan. Advanced diagnostic tools, such as X-rays and posture analysis, aid in developing targeted and effective interventions.

Preparing for Your Chiropractic Visit and Setting Expectations When visiting a chiropractor, patients can expect a thorough assessment that includes a detailed medical history, physical examination, and, if necessary, imaging studies. The chiropractor will discuss the findings and recommend a treatment plan tailored to the individual’s condition and goals. Initial visits may focus on alleviating pain and restoring function, followed by ongoing maintenance sessions to support long-term health. Communication between patient and practitioner is essential, ensuring that treatment objectives, progress, and lifestyle recommendations are clearly understood.
